Abstract
Basalts from Sao Miguel are displaced to higher 87Sr/86Sr ratios, and have a significantly shallower slope, compared with the main correlation between 143Nd/144Nd and 87Sr/86Sr for most mantle-derived volcanic rocks. Available data on young magmatic rocks indicate that large ionic lithophile (LIL)-element enrichment in the upper mantle involves two readily distinguishable components which reflect different histories.
